English Folk Expo at Exeter Phoenix

English Folk Expo at Exeter Phoenix

Throughout the summer, English Folk Expo presents a range of live and live streamed concerts across the country

For July English Folk Expo presents a series of concerts from the Exeter Pheonix. Each concert is available to watch in venue or watch from home.

Tuesday 20th July, 8pm English Folk Expo Presents: Sam Sweeney

Nominated four times, and winner in 2015, of Musician Of The Year BBC Radio 2 Folk Awards, Sam Sweeney is a veteran of the mighty Bellowhead, former and inaugural artistic director of the National Youth Folk Ensemble, founder member of the acclaimed instrumental trio Leveret, and “one of the defining English fiddle players of his generation” (Mark Radcliffe) at the forefront of the revival in English traditional music.

Sam has also recorded and performed with The Full English, Eliza Carthy, Jon Boden & The Remnant Kings, Fay Hield & The Hurricane Party, Emily Portman, Martin Carthy, as well as his own critically acclaimed show Made In The Great War.

Wednesday 21st July, 8pm English Folk Expo Presents: Kathryn Roberts & Sean Lakeman

Kathryn Roberts and Sean Lakeman have long established themselves as one of the UK folk scene’s most rewardingly enduring partnerships. Duos come and duos go… And some nurture and fine tune their art and watch it grow into something totally original, captivating and award-winning.

Bonded by an unseen alchemy, Kathryn Roberts and Sean Lakeman have entwined their professional and personal relationship into an enviable class act of imaginative songwriting and musicianship.

Over two decades of performance they have never been trapped in a groove – always bold and innovative, mixing traditional song arrangements with their self-penned material which reels from the bitter to the sweet, the wry to the sad, the political to the passive.

Thursday 22nd July, 8pm English Folk Expo Presents: Sound of the Sirens

Westcountry folk-rock duo Sound of the Sirens have released two albums so far “This Time” in 2019 and their debut album “For All Our Sins” was released in 2017 to wide praise including from R2 Magazine who called it a “stunning debut collection”.

Current album “This Time” continues to showcase an evident gift for crafting unique, vivid and enduring melodies with 15 catchy and heartfelt songs all written by Sound of the Sirens, aka Abbe Martin and Hannah Wood, whose voices harmonise beautifully throughout the album.

A new album is planned for release in 2021 and you can expect to hear some new songs debuted at shows.

Their live shows combine a natural facility for connecting with their audiences and unforgettable performances with warmth, humour and, above all, real conviction.

English Folk Expo (EFEx) is a charity which supports the English folk, roots and acoustic music sector through a variety of projects and initiatives. We host festivals and events throughout the year to introduce the best folk, roots and acoustic music to new and existing audiences.
